Interim Resolution Professional
(IRP)
Upon admission of a Corporate Insolvency Resolution Process (CIRP) by the National Company Law Tribunal (NCLT), the Interim Resolution Professional assumes critical responsibility for stabilizing and administering the corporate debtor.
Scope of IRP Responsibilities:
- Taking control and custody of assets and records
- Issuing public announcement under IBC
- Collating and verifying creditor claims
- Constituting the Committee of Creditors (CoC)
Our structured approach ensures operational continuity while protecting the value of distressed entities during the initial phase of insolvency proceedings.
Resolution Professional (RP) – Corporate Insolvency Resolution Process (CIRP)
As Resolution Professionals, we manage the complete Corporate Insolvency Resolution Process in accordance with the statutory framework of the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code, 2016.
Our RP Services Include:
- Conducting Committee of Creditors meetings
- Preparing and circulating Information Memorandum
- Coordinating with registered valuers
- Inviting and evaluating resolution plans
- Verifying eligibility of resolution applicants
- Filing statutory applications before NCLT
Our objective is to facilitate viable, legally compliant resolution plans that balance commercial feasibility with creditor interests.
Liquidation Services (Voluntary &
Compulsory)
Where resolution is not feasible, liquidation becomes the statutory pathway. DSP Professionals undertakes liquidation assignments in accordance with IBC provisions and regulatory guidelines.
Liquidation Services Include:
- Identification and preservation of assets
- Appointment and coordination with valuers
- Asset sale through e-auction or approved mechanisms
- Settlement of creditor claims
- Distribution of proceeds as per Section 53 waterfall mechanism
- Preparation and filing of statutory reports
We ensure transparent asset realization, procedural integrity, and compliant closure of liquidation proceedings.
